Artificial Intelligence, Predictive Analytics, Agile 4.0, Project Management, Digital Transformation, Data-Driven Decision Making, Operational Efficiency, Risk ManagementAbstract
This paper aims at analyzing the significance of the shift from conventional project management practices to AI, Predictive Analytics, and Agile 4.0. The research focuses on how these technologies are making data-driven decisions, decision-making processes more effective, and helping project managers in making decisions regarding risks and resources. The use of artificial intelligence to automate the process, thus using advanced analytics for risk assessment, and embracing Agile 4.0 for flexibility and communications ensure that actual decisions about project plans can also be made in real time. However, the study also recognizes that there are potential issues associated with the use of such technologies such as security, organizational resistance and specialized skill requirements. This paper looks at these technologies with regard to their effects on project management, the challenges of adopting them, and how these can be overcome in order to attain operational efficiency. The findings also add to the literature on digital transformation in project management, and provide guidelines for other organisations to apply in the future.
